18815004 | Illness perceptions in patients with fibromyalgia. | 2009 Jan | OBJECTIVE: Former studies in chronic diseases showed the importance of patients' beliefs and perceptions. The Revised Illness Perception Questionnaire was developed to assess these illness perceptions. Our goal was to investigate psychometric properties of the IPQ-R for Fibromyalgia Dutch language version (IPQ-R FM-Dlv) and to describe illness perceptions of participants with FM. METHODS: 196 patients completed the IPQ-R FM-Dlv. Internal consistency, domain structure and inter domain correlations were calculated and compared to the IPQ-R English language version. Scores were compared with chronic fatigue syndrome (CFS), rheumatoid arthritis (RA), and coronary heart disease (CHD). RESULTS: Most psychometric properties were comparable to those of the original IPQ-R. Participants showed a lack of understanding of their illness, expected their FM to be chronic and to have a lot of negative consequences on functioning. In 17 out of 24 domains significant differences were found between FM and CFS, RA, and CHD patients. CONCLUSION: The IPQ-R FM-Dlv showed acceptable psychometric properties, although some aspects need closer examination. Illness perceptions of FM patients on the Dutch questionnaire were non-comparable to CFS, RA, and CHD patients on the English questionnaire. PRACTICE IMPLICATIONS: The IPQ-R FM-Dlv can be used to assess illness perceptions of Dutch FM patients. | |
19777949 | [Radiosynovectomy of the knee--experience thereof]. | 2009 May | The aim of the study was the evaluation of 90Y radiosynovectomy performed in chronic exudative knee synovitis. The analyzed material comprised 81 90Y injections made between 2004 and 2008. The circumference of a knee, the volume of removed exudate, the knee mobility, the presence of pain, the temperature of a knee and the presence of floating patella (exudate) were evaluated. The percentage of pain-free patients increased from 12% to 50% after 1 year; an additional 10% of patients reported pain relief. The patient percentage with an increased knee temperature fell from 42% to 31% and the patients percentage with exudates decreased from 76% to 27. No improvement was found with respect to knee circumference. The knee mobility improvement (the patients percentage with full mobility) increased from 25% to 59% one month after the treatment) and exudate volume reduction was found only in the subgroup of patients suffering from pigmented villonodular synovitis. The obtained results permit the conclusion that 90Y radiosynovectomy for chronic exudative knee synovitis is an effective treatment modality; it relieves pain and reduces the patients percentage with exudate and increased knee temperature, and in the subgroup of patients suffering from the pigmented villonodular synovitis improves the knee mobility and reduces the volume of evacuated exudate. | |
20937671 | Inhibition of joint damage and improved clinical outcomes with rituximab plus methotrexate | 2011 Jan | OBJECTIVES: Rituximab is an effective treatment in patients with established rheumatoid arthritis (RA). The objective of the IMAGE study was to determine the efficacy of rituximab in the prevention of joint damage and its safety in combination with methotrexate (MTX) in patients initiating treatment with MTX. METHODS: In this double-blind randomised controlled phase III study, 755 MTX-naïve patients with active RA were randomly assigned to MTX alone, rituximab 2×500 mg + MTX or rituximab 2×1000 mg + MTX. The primary end point at week 52 was the change in joint damage measured using a Genant-modified Sharp score. RESULTS: 249, 249 and 250 patients were randomly assigned to MTX alone, rituximab 2×500 mg + MTX or rituximab 2×1000 mg + MTX, respectively. At week 52, treatment with rituximab 2×1000 mg + MTX compared with MTX alone was associated with a reduction in progression of joint damage (mean change in total modified Sharp score 0.359 vs 1.079; p=0.0004) and an improvement in clinical outcomes (ACR50 65% vs 42%; p<0.0001); rituximab 2×500 mg + MTX improved clinical outcomes (ACR50 59% vs 42%; p<0.0001) compared with MTX alone but did not significantly reduce the progression of joint damage. Safety outcomes were similar between treatment groups. CONCLUSIONS: Treatment with rituximab 2×1000 mg in combination with MTX is an effective therapy for the treatment of patients with MTX-naïve RA. ClinicalTrials.gov identifier NCT00299104. | |
19949830 | DNA methylation and not allelic variation regulates STAT6 expression in human T cells. | 2010 Sep | STAT6 transcription factor, which has been implicated in commitment to Th2, is known to be activated by IL-4 and IL-13. Accordingly, STAT6 is primarily responsible for the transcriptional effects of IL-4 and IL-13. STAT6-deficient mice are known to have defective IL-4-mediated functions, such as B cell proliferation, Th2 cell development and IgE secretion; therefore, they primarily contain the Th1 phenotype. However, the mechanism responsible for regulation of STAT6 expression transcriptionally and post-transcriptionally has yet to be elucidated. Here, we characterized the human STAT6 promoter gene and found that the transcriptional regulatory elements CCAAT and ATF were important for the STAT6 promoter activity. Direct sequencing analysis revealed that the 13 GT repeat allelic variation in noncoding exon 1 of the STAT6 gene appeared more frequently in 91 patients with asthma or rheumatoid arthritis than the 15 GT repeat variation, which is the dominant phenotype in healthy controls. However, it appears that this allelic variation did not affect the STAT6 transcriptional activity. Interestingly, treatment with a DNA methyltransferase inhibitor markedly increased the expression of STAT6 mRNA and protein in human primary T cells. In contrast, IFN-gamma treatment significantly repressed the STAT6 transcriptional activity. Therefore, the present study provides insight into the molecular basis of STAT6 expression, and in particular, demonstrates that STAT6 expression is associated with DNA hypermethylation rather than promoter polymorphisms or allelic variations. | |
20552246 | Etanercept response in patients with rheumatoid arthritis after secondary loss of efficacy | 2010 Dec | This study was carried out to determine the effectiveness of half-dose administration of etanercept in patients with rheumatoid arthritis (RA) who exhibited secondary loss of efficacy of infliximab. Seventeen patients were administered 25 mg of etanercept once weekly for at least 1 year after secondary loss of efficacy of infliximab. The mean duration of treatment with infliximab was 32.5 ± 1.3 months. The patient cohort consisted of 3 males and 14 females, with a mean age of 56.3 ± 11.4 years and mean weight of 57.2 ± 10.9 kg. The mean duration of RA was 16.2 ± 10.9 years. The mean Disease Activity Score 28 was decreased significantly, from 5.8 at the initiation of infliximab therapy to 3.6 at the end of observation. There were no withdrawals due to adverse reactions during the study period, although in 2 subjects the agent was changed to tocilizumab due to lack of effect, one after 18 months and the other after 36 months, and 1 subject withdrew after 18 months for financial reasons. A good response can be expected to a half dose of etanercept in patients with secondary loss of efficacy of infliximab. Reduction of the patient's cost burden also makes this a superior treatment. | |
19846884 | Novel role of Pin1 induction in type II collagen-mediated rheumatoid arthritis. | 2009 Nov 15 | Rheumatoid arthritis (RA) is an autoimmune disease characterized by chronic inflammation in joints and subsequent destruction of cartilage and bone. Inflammatory mediators such as PGs and proinflammatory cytokines contribute to RA progress. Pin1, a peptidyl prolyl isomerase, plays important pathophysiological roles in several diseases, including cancer and neurodegeneration. We found that both Pin1 and cyclooxygenase-2 (COX-2) were highly expressed in ankle tissues of type II collagen-induced RA mice. HTB-94 cells overexpressing Pin1 and primary cultured human chondrocytes showed increased basal expression of proinflammatory proteins (COX-2, inducible NO synthase, TNF-alpha, and IL-1beta). Site-directed mutagenesis revealed that Pin1-mediated transcriptional activation of COX-2 was coordinately regulated by NF-kappaB, CREB, and C/EBP. Gel shift, reporter gene, and Western blot analyses confirmed that NF-kappaB, CREB, and C/EBP were consistently activated in chondrocytes overexpressing Pin1. Treatment of RA mice with juglone, a chemical inhibitor of Pin1, significantly reduced RA progress and COX-2 expression in the ankle tissues. Moreover, juglone dose dependently decreased the basal COX-2 expression in primary cultured chondrocytes from RA patients. These results demonstrate that Pin1 induction during RA progress stimulates proinflammatory protein expression by activating NF-kappaB, CREB, and C/EBP, and suggest that Pin1 is a potential therapeutic target of RA. | |
19332630 | Postmarketing surveillance of the safety and effectiveness of etanercept in Japan. | 2009 May | OBJECTIVE: Postmarketing surveillance (PMS) was conducted evaluating safety and effectiveness of etanercept (ETN; Enbrel) in Japan, following all patients with rheumatoid arthritis (RA) during the conditional approval period of ETN. METHODS: Registration of patients from 1,334 medical sites was conducted between March 2005 and April 2007. Patients were followed for 24 weeks; data regarding patients' background, safety, and effectiveness was recorded centrally. Adverse events (AE) and adverse drug reactions (ADR) were coded using the Medical Dictionary for Regulatory Activities. Effectiveness was measured using the Disease Activity Score 28 (DAS28). RESULTS: Of 14,369 patients registered, data collection and evaluation for 7,091 patients by March 2006 is reported. At least 1 AE was observed for 2,173 patients (30.6%); 60% of AE occurred within 8 weeks of starting ETN. Most frequent AE were injection site reaction (n = 377, 5.3%) and rash (n = 228, 3.2%). Serious AE occurred in 403 patients (5.7%); most frequent were pneumonia (n = 59, 0.8%) and interstitial lung disease (n = 42, 0.6%). Pneumonia was the most common specifically important ADR (n = 102, 1.4%). Mean baseline DAS28 was 6.0, which reduced to 4.4 within 4 weeks, and to 3.9 within 24 weeks. The proportion of patients having good or moderate EULAR response measured by DAS28 was 84.1% at Week 24. Effectiveness rates were more favorable in patients concomitantly using methotrexate. Good or moderate EULAR response rate among patients switched from infliximab was 84.9%. CONCLUSION: This extensive observational trial, including all patients with RA in Japan taking ETN, found ETN to be both effective and well tolerated by Japanese patients with RA. TRIAL REGISTRATION: clinicaltrials.gov identifier NCT00503503. | |
20149310 | Hypoxia inducible factor-1-alpha (HIF-1alpha) is related to both angiogenesis and inflamma | 2009 Nov | OBJECTIVES: Despite the important role of the transcription factor HIF-1alpha in angiogenesis and inflammation, only a few studies on HIF-1alpha expression have been performed in RA patients. The aim of the present study was to identify the layer in synovial tissue of RA patients where HIF1a is expressed and to find out whether HIF-1alpha expression is related to both angiogenesis and inflammation in synovium from RA patients. METHODS: A reproducible staining method for HIF-1alpha was developed. HIF-1alpha -positive cells were quantified in synovial tissue from patients with RA. As control we used synovial tissue from patients with osteoarthritis (OA). The number of HIF-1alpha-positive cells was compared with the number of blood vessels present and was correlated with the amount of inflammation. The amount of inflammation was determined by counting inflammatory cells, by estimating the proliferation marker Ki67 in inflamed tissue, and by using a recently published synovitis score which gives an accurate estimate of the amount of inflammation present. RESULTS: HIF-1alpha was expressed weakly in the lining layer and strongly in the sublining layer in RA synovial tissue. In contrast, HIF-1alpha was only weakly expressed in OA synovial tissue. The number of HIF-1alpha -positive cells correlated strongly with the number of blood vessels in RA synovial tissue and with inflammatory endothelial cell infiltration (blood vessels), cell proliferation (Ki67) and the synovitis score. CONCLUSIONS: HIF-1alpha expression is strongest in the sub-lining layer of RA synovium and is related to both angiogenesis and inflammation in synovium from RA patients. These results thus suggest that HIF-1alpha could serve as an important new therapeutic target in RA, targeting both angiogenesis and inflammation. | |
20607810 | Formulation and evaluation of quercetin polycaprolactone microspheres for the treatment of | 2011 Jan | Quercetin had been shown to be effective in the management of arthritis. However, bioavailability of quercetin is a concern for such treatment. This work aims at the development of intra-articular drug delivery system by controlled release of quercetin (loaded in microspheres) for the management of rheumatoid arthritis. Polycaprolactone has been used for the preparation of microspheres (with quercetin) using the solvent evaporation method. The physio-chemical characterisation of polycaprolactone-loaded quercetin microspheres was carried out to obtain information about particle size distribution, drug loading efficiency, morphology, thermal properties, polymorphism and release trends in phosphate-buffered saline at pH 7.4 and 37°C. Quercetin-loaded polycaprolactone microspheres were found to be biocompatible as evidenced from in vitro and in vivo studies using a rabbit synovial cells and Wistar rats, respectively. Quercetin release from microspheres of selected formulations showed biphasic nature due to initial burst effect followed by a controlled release. These results suggest that optimised quercetin-loaded polycaprolactone microspheres may be the viable strategy for controlled release of quercetin in the joint cavity for more than 30 days by intra-articular injection to treat rheumatoid arthritis. | |
18828180 | Molecular studies of rheumatoid factor using pseudobioaffinity membrane chromatography. | 2009 Mar | Using pseudobioaffinity ligand L-histidine immobilized to poly(ethylene vinyl alcohol) hollow fiber membrane is an interesting approach for the purification of total IgG and its subclasses from untreated serum in a single step. Gentle adsorption and elution conditions of this chromatography system allow efficient recovery of the protein in its native form. This approach was employed for the recovery and molecular study of rheumatoid factor (RF), an anti-IgG autoantibody (AAb) that form immune complexes with autologous IgG Abs in the sera. The purity of the recovered molecule was analyzed on sodium dodecyl sulfate-polyacrylamide gel electrophoresis (SDS-PAGE), revealed a 150-kDa IgG band and an additional approximately 300 kDa band which may be RF bound IgG complex. Since RF is an AAb, the purified protein was studied for its catalytic functions like peptide, DNA, and RNA hydrolyzing activities. The substrate Pro-Phe-Arg-4-methyl-coumaryl-7-amide (PFR-MCA) hydrolyzing activity by total IgG from different patient sera was found to be greater than healthy controls. In an effort to identify the subclass specificity for the proteolytic function, the pre-purified total IgG fractions from rheumatoid arthritis (RA) sera were subjected to rechromatography using a discriminating buffer. In this experiment, the activity was found in the non-retained fractions suggesting IgG2 specificity for the catalytic function. A comparative study between different catalytic functions was performed for IgG separated from individual patient. | |
21119171 | Simultaneous bilateral versus unilateral total ankle replacement: a patient-based comparis | 2010 Dec | The aim of this study was to compare the outcome of bilateral sequential total ankle replacement (TAR) with that of unilateral TAR. We reviewed 23 patients who had undergone sequential bilateral TAR under a single anaesthetic and 46 matched patients with a unilateral TAR. There were no significant pre-operative differences between the two groups in terms of age, gender, body mass index, American Society of Anaesthesiologists classification and aetiology of the osteoarthritis of the ankle. Clinical and radiological follow-up was carried out at four months, one and two years. After four months, patients with simultaneous bilateral TAR reported a significantly higher mean pain score than those with a unilateral TAR. The mean American Orthopaedic Foot and Ankle Society hindfoot score and short-form 36 physical component summary score were better in the unilateral group. However, this difference disappeared at the one-and two-year follow-ups. Bilateral sequential TAR under one anaesthetic can be offered to patients with bilateral severe ankle osteoarthritis. However, they should be informed of the long recovery period. | |
20112284 | TLR4-dependent induction of vascular adhesion molecule-1 in rheumatoid arthritis synovial | 2010 May | Lipopolysaccharide (LPS)/Toll-like receptor 4 (TLR4)-mediated signaling pathways have caught the attention of strategies designed for rheumatoid arthritis (RA). In this study, we identified that cPLA(2)alpha acted as a modulator of LPS-induced VCAM-1 expression and THP-1 (human acute monocytic leukemia cell line) adherence. Treatment of RA synovial fibroblasts (RASFs) with LPS, a TLR4 agonist, promoted the VCAM-1 expression and THP-1 adherence which were decreased by pretreatment with a selective cytosolic phospholipase A(2) (cPLA(2)) inhibitor (AACOCF(3)), implying the involvement of cPLA(2)alpha in these responses. This notion was further confirmed by knockdown of cPLA(2)alpha expression by transfection with cPLA(2)alpha small interfering RNA (siRNA) leading to a decrease in VCAM-1 expression and THP-1 adherence induced by LPS. Subsequently, the LPS-stimulated cPLA(2)alpha phosphorylation was attenuated by pretreatment with a MEK1/2 inhibitor (U0126), suggesting that LPS-stimulated cPLA(2)alpha phosphorylation and activity are mediated through an ERK-dependent mechanism. Moreover, COX-2-derived PGE(2) production appeared to involve in LPS-induced VCAM-1 expression which was attenuated by pretreatment with selective COX-2 inhibitors (NS-398 and celecoxib), transfection with COX-2 siRNA, or PGE(2) receptor antagonists. In addition, pretreatment with ecosapentaenoic acid (EPA), a substrate competitor of arachidonic acid (AA), also blocked LPS-induced VCAM-1 mRNA and protein expression, and THP-1 adherence. Collectively, these results suggest that LPS-induced VCAM-1 expression and adhesion of THP-1 cells are mediated through the TLR4/ERK/cPLA(2)alpha phosphorylation and COX-2 expression/PGE(2) synthesis in RASFs. | |
21299548 | Pneumocystis jirovecii colonization in patients treated with infliximab. | 2011 Mar | BACKGROUND: Infliximab, a chimeric antitumour necrosis factor (TNF) monoclonal antibody, has become an established effective therapy for inflammatory rheumatic disease. However, TNF is a critical factor in host defence, and the suppression of its biological activity may be associated with the increased risk of opportunistic infections. The frequent use of infliximab in clinical practice has identified Pneumocystis jirovecii pneumonia (PcP) as a serious complication. Individuals colonized with Pneumocystis may be at high risk of development of PcP when they have undergone immunosuppression. Hence, we addressed the question of the frequency of Pneumocystis colonization among patients treated with infliximab. DESIGN: We examined 125 oropharyngeal washes collected from 78 individuals with rheumatoid arthritis, 30 with ankylosing spondylitis and 17 with psoriatic arthritis, half of them underwent infliximab therapy, using a real-time polymerase chain reaction assay that employs specific primers from a portion of the mitochondrial large-subunit rRNA gene of P. jirovecii. RESULTS: Pneumocystis jirovecii colonization was detected in 32 (25·6%) patients. In a multivariate regression model, only duration of infliximab treatment for more than 3 years and use of corticosteroid were significantly and independently associated with risk of Pneumocystis colonization. However, the effect of corticosteroid on P. jirovecii colonization rate was not linearly dose dependent as showed other logistic regression analysis. CONCLUSIONS: There is a high rate of P. jirovecii colonization among patients with rheumatologic diseases treated with infliximab. The identification of patients colonized by P. jirovecii before starting the treatment with infliximab could be a strategy for PcP prevention. | |
20235204 | Electronic medical records for discovery research in rheumatoid arthritis. | 2010 Aug | OBJECTIVE: Electronic medical records (EMRs) are a rich data source for discovery research but are underutilized due to the difficulty of extracting highly accurate clinical data. We assessed whether a classification algorithm incorporating narrative EMR data (typed physician notes) more accurately classifies subjects with rheumatoid arthritis (RA) compared with an algorithm using codified EMR data alone. METHODS: Subjects with > or =1 International Classification of Diseases, Ninth Revision RA code (714.xx) or who had anti-cyclic citrullinated peptide (anti-CCP) checked in the EMR of 2 large academic centers were included in an "RA Mart" (n = 29,432). For all 29,432 subjects, we extracted narrative (using natural language processing) and codified RA clinical information. In a training set of 96 RA and 404 non-RA cases from the RA Mart classified by medical record review, we used narrative and codified data to develop classification algorithms using logistic regression. These algorithms were applied to the entire RA Mart. We calculated and compared the positive predictive value (PPV) of these algorithms by reviewing the records of an additional 400 subjects classified as having RA by the algorithms. RESULTS: A complete algorithm (narrative and codified data) classified RA subjects with a significantly higher PPV of 94% than an algorithm with codified data alone (PPV of 88%). Characteristics of the RA cohort identified by the complete algorithm were comparable to existing RA cohorts (80% women, 63% anti-CCP positive, and 59% positive for erosions). CONCLUSION: We demonstrate the ability to utilize complete EMR data to define an RA cohort with a PPV of 94%, which was superior to an algorithm using codified data alone. | |
20097032 | Wear comparison between a highly cross-linked polyethylene and conventional polyethylene a | 2011 Jan | Highly cross-linked polyethylene (HXLPE) was developed to reduce wear of articular bearing surface in total hip arthroplasty patients. Several studies have shown reduced wear of HXLPE compared with conventional polyethylene; however, these studies had used HXLPE in combination with a Co-Cr metal head. The purpose of this study was to compare the 5-year in vivo wear of HXLPE with that of conventional PE using a zirconia femoral head. Forty-five hips with a Trilogy HXLPE (Zimmer, Warsaw, Ind) were matched and compared with a control group of 20 conventional Trilogy PE hips. The 2-dimensional linear wear rate was significantly less in the HXLPE group between 1 and 5 years postoperation (P < .001). The results show that HXLPE reduces short-term polyethylene wear against not only a Co-Cr head but also a zirconia head. | |
20008917 | Can tumor necrosis factor inhibitors be safely used in pregnancy? | 2010 Jan | OBJECTIVE: We review available safety data for use of currently approved tumor necrosis factor (TNF) inhibitors during pregnancy and lactation and suggest guidelines for use of these agents among women of reproductive age. Method. Although regulatory agencies encourage the inclusion of pregnant women and those of child-bearing age in randomized controlled trials, pregnant and lactating women have universally been excluded from studies because of unknown or potential risks to the fetus. Thus, strong evidence-based treatment recommendations during pregnancy are usually lacking and safety information is derived from voluntary reports of adverse events during postmarketing surveillance or via uncontrolled, observational studies, reviewed here. RESULTS: Uncommon adverse pregnancy outcomes observed with TNF inhibitor therapy appear to approximate those seen in women not receiving such therapy and may include premature birth, miscarriage, low birthweight, hypertension, and preeclampsia. There are rare reports of fetal malformations or congenital anomalies in patients exposed to TNF inhibitors during conception or pregnancy. However, the incidence of these events appears to be far below the 3% rate of congenital anomalies in the general population. CONCLUSION: If the activity or disease severity precludes the cessation of a TNF inhibitor and/or DMARD, uncontrolled observations suggest that conception and early pregnancy are not adversely affected by use of TNF inhibitors. Nearly 70% of pregnant patients can discontinue their TNF inhibitor early in the pregnancy (or with determination of pregnancy) without augmenting maternal or fetal risks. | |
20007287 | Positron emission tomography/computed tomography: a clinical tool for evaluation of enthes | 2010 Feb | OBJECTIVE: To evaluate the accuracy of PET/CT using [(18)F]fluorodeoxyglucose (FDG) in determining the presence of enthesitis in patients with SpAs. METHODS: Results of PET/CT scans of eight patients with SpA and seven patients with RA were retrospectively examined, with specific focus on five joints and three entheses. Volume fixation values are expressed as standardized uptake values (SUVs). Data from 20 patients with non-rheumatic (NR) diseases and 20 healthy subjects were also examined if non-specific, false positive findings were possible. We evaluated the clinical utility of PET/CT examinations in SpA, compared with MRI and Ga scintigraphy. RESULTS: Images of PET/CT scans of the shoulder, hip and knee joints revealed that FDG accumulated at the entheses in SpA and in the synovium in RA patients. The maximum SUVs [mean (s.d.)] were statistically higher in SpA patients compared with RA patients at the entheses of lumbar spinous process [4.83 (1.15) vs 1.42 (0.34); P < 0.05, respectively], pubic symphysis [3.93 (0.87) vs 1.35 (0.31); P < 0.05, respectively] and ischial tuberosity [4.76 (1.5) vs 1.35 (0.42); P < 0.05, respectively]. The positive frequencies of lumbar spinous processes and ischial tuberosity evaluated by PET/CT scan in the SpA group were significantly higher than that evaluated by MRI. CONCLUSION: MRI is now widely used to detect bone marrow oedema and enthesitis in patients with SpA. PET/CT scans offer an alternative method to identify enthesitis, and will likely contribute to the early diagnosis of SpA. | |
19318947 | Environmental influences on risk for rheumatoid arthritis. | 2009 May | PURPOSE OF REVIEW: To examine new environmental factors and provide updates on known risk factors for rheumatoid arthritis (RA) in the past 2 years (2006-2008). This review is timely given the expanding information on treatment, pathogenesis and genetic risk factors for RA. RECENT FINDINGS: High consumption of red meat does not increase risk of RA, whereas alcohol intake may be protective. The role of vitamin D and oral contraceptives as modifiers of disease risk remains equivocal. Other factors associated with increased risk of RA include higher birthweight, living in the northeastern United States compared with other regions of the country, and lower socioeconomic status. Duration of breastfeeding is inversely associated with RA risk. Several studies have now demonstrated that anti-citrullinated protein antibody positive RA has a specific association with environmental risk factors such as smoking. SUMMARY: Recent studies have increased our understanding of environmental exposures that modify risk for RA such as smoking and alcohol intake. Other factors such as birthweight, breastfeeding, socioeconomic status and region of birth have also been demonstrated to contribute to risk. ACPA status is associated with specific environmental factors and is therefore important to incorporate into present and future studies. | |
19546078 | [Effectiveness and safety of biological therapy with adalimumab]. | 2009 Jun 28 | Adalimumab is a human, recombinant antibody, which is effective in patients with rheumatoid arthritis, polyarticular juvenile idiopathic arthritis, psoriasis, arthritis psoriatica, spondylitis ankylopoetica, as well as with Crohn-disease. Adalimumab has got a high affinity binding to tumor necrosis factor (TNF-alfa), this way it inhibits the interactions with TNF and its receptors (soluble and membrane associated). It is well tolerated and safe, it improves the the quality of life. Possible side effects can be decreased by the careful observation and usual control of patients. The authors discuss in detail the publications on adalimumab in the above mentioned diseases. | |
21187298 | Effectiveness and safety of the interleukin 6-receptor antagonist tocilizumab after 4 and | 2011 May | OBJECTIVES: To confirm the effectiveness and safety of the interleukin 6-receptor antagonist tocilizumab in patients with rheumatoid arthritis (RA) in a setting close to real-life medical care in Germany. METHODS: A multicentre open-label phase IIIb study was undertaken. Patients with active RA with a 28-joint Disease Activity Score (DAS28) >3.2 despite previous disease-modifying antirheumatic drugs (DMARDs) were treated with tocilizumab 8 mg/kg every 4 weeks. The primary end point was the proportion of patients achieving LDAS ≤3.2 at week 24; secondary end points included American College of Rheumatology (ACR), European League Against Rheumatism (EULAR) or Clinical Disease Activity Index (CDAI) responses and decrease in acute phase. Analyses in subgroups such as rheumatoid factor (RF)-positive versus RF-negative patients and patients with an inadequate response to treatment with DMARDs (DMARD-IR) versus those with an inadequate response to tumour necrosis factor (TNF) antagonists (TNF antagonist-IR) were performed. Safety was assessed by adverse event documentation. RESULTS: 286 patients were treated and 83.6% completed the study. 41.6% had previously been treated with TNF antagonists. 57% of the intention-to-treat patients achieved the primary end point of LDAS, 47.6% achieved DAS remission <2.6 and a EULAR 'good response' was achieved by 54.9%; ACR50/70 response rates at week 24 were 50.7% and 33.9%, respectively. The mean±SD decrease in CDAI from baseline to week 24 was 71±29%. C reactive protein levels normalised rapidly within 1 week. Major improvements in fatigue, pain and morning stiffness were observed in the first 4 weeks and further improved until week 24. DAS28, EULAR and ACR responses at week 24 did not differ between RF-positive and RF-negative patients. TNF antagonist-naive patients responded better than patients who had previously failed on TNF antagonists. The safety profile of tocilizumab was comparable to that previously observed in the phase III trial programme. Serious infections were observed in 3.1% of patients. CONCLUSIONS: Tocilizumab is highly effective in a setting close to real-life medical care with a rapid and sustained improvement in signs and symptoms of RA. A manageable safety profile was seen over the 24-week study period. |
